Where do I search for Summit County public records? ▼
Public records in Summit County come from separate departments. All court filings go through the Clerk of Courts. For property ownership and values, check the County Auditor. For marriage records, contact the Probate Court.

Is there a single database for all Summit County records? ▼
No. Every office in Summit County maintains its own search system. None are connected.
